Ticket: Staging env misconfigured for Siftgate bloom filter

The bloom layer in front of the Pellet KV store is rejecting all lookups in staging because the env file was copied from the dev template without credentials. False-positive tuning values are fine; only the auth line is missing. To unblock the weekly demo, the Pellet admission secret must be set on the following line.

env line for yaguf-fajop: LEDGER_TOKEN13=fb08984397349

Handover Note — From Director Pell to Director Yarrow, copied to Heads of Department, Quorrin Fabrics

Tomas, here's where the headcount plan stands for next year. We've pencilled in 22 net additions, weighted toward the Milverton plant and the dye-works team. Finance hasn't blessed the final number yet, so keep it loose with your managers. Two senior roles are contingent on the Aster line landing. The sensitive piece on where this is all heading sits just below.

management briefing: The renewal with Zoraelax Group closes at $10 million a year, 15 percent below the last contract. Project Ralael slips by six weeks because of the audit delay.

Q: How do I follow a request across services?

A: Every inbound request gets a trace ID at the Gatewright edge. It propagates via the x-corvid-trace header; if a service drops it, spans orphan and Lanternview shows gaps. Don't mint new IDs mid-chain. Sampling is 10% in prod, 100% in staging. If spans are missing, check the header first, then the collector queue depth. Full propagation rules and debugging steps are on this page.

dashboard of bafof-hafog = https://confluence.lumiclabs.internal/display/browse/display/6a09a20a

Finance Review Summary — Large-Deal Discounting

Welcome aboard! Quick picture before your first pricing committee: discounts above 20% on Orvane Suite deals have crept up to a third of large contracts, and margin on those is roughly six points below plan. We've tightened approvals — anything past 25% now needs finance sign-off, no exceptions, even for the Halbrook account. Renewal uplift clauses are helping, slowly. Full workings are in the shared ledger. One item stays strictly between us, set out below.

internal memo for yahag-hahig: Belwynix Group plans to lower the Silir list price by 62 percent in May.